Grete Grindal Patil is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, General Health Professions and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Grete Grindal Patil has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 1.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 10 papers in General Health Professions and 9 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Grete Grindal Patil’s work include Urban Green Space and Health (22 papers), Health, psychology, and well-being (7 papers) and Olfactory and Sensory Function Studies (7 papers). Grete Grindal Patil is often cited by papers focused on Urban Green Space and Health (22 papers), Health, psychology, and well-being (7 papers) and Olfactory and Sensory Function Studies (7 papers). Grete Grindal Patil collaborates with scholars based in Norway, Sweden and The Netherlands. Grete Grindal Patil's co-authors include Terry Hartig, Ruth Kjærsti Raanaas, Ingeborg Pedersen, Marianne Thorsen Gonzalez and Siren Eriksen and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Journal of Advanced Nursing and Journal of Environmental Psychology.
